🥘 Ingredients

4 items
  • 8 cups Whole milk
  • 0.5 cups Plain yogurt with live cultures (starter)
  • 1 teaspoons Vanilla extract (optional)
  • 2 tablespoons Sugar or honey (optional)

📝 Instructions

9 steps
1

Pour the whole milk into the crock pot. Cover with the lid.

2

Set the crock pot to the 'low' setting and let it heat the milk for 2.5 hours.

3

After 2.5 hours, turn off the crock pot but leave the lid on. Let the milk cool for an additional 3 hours. You want the milk temperature to drop to about 110°F (43°C).

4

In a small bowl, mix the plain yogurt starter with 1 cup of the warm milk from the crock pot. Whisk until smooth.

5

Gently pour the yogurt-milk mixture back into the crock pot and stir well to combine. At this point, you can add vanilla extract or sugar/honey for flavor, if desired.

6

Cover the crock pot with its lid and wrap the entire crock pot with a thick towel to insulate it. Let it sit, undisturbed, for 8-12 hours or overnight. This is when the yogurt will culture and thicken.

7

After the incubation period, check the consistency of the yogurt. It will have thickened slightly and will continue to thicken once chilled.

8

Transfer the yogurt into airtight containers and refrigerate for at least 4 hours before serving.

9

Serve plain or with your favorite toppings such as fresh fruit, granola, or honey. Enjoy!
